We take our skills, materials and equipment into our feeder schools to assist the teachers with the practical work.
Hand in glove with this we use the time to train the teachers in some focused techniques to help them develop their skills in teaching design.
We have developed projects for the fairground theme, vehicles and picture frames. We have also had pupils visit the school to use our food facilities to make biscuits.
We use our facilities and buy in workshops for our own pupils and for other schools as part of the community outreach programme.
Primary schools are keen to use the department’s expertise to help bring designing and making into the primary experience. For the secondary schools we offer a wide range of support from visits to providing INSET training. One of our fields of expertise is in the use of CAD/CAM. Martin Chandler is a trainer for the Pro/DESKTOP software and all the staff use a variety of software including Techsoft 2D Design, Photoshop, Speedstep and many more. We have an array of machines for producing CAM products and the local CTLC has a 3D rapid prototype machine.
